B.Sc. in Chemistry (Hons.) program provides an in-depth understanding of the fundamental studies of chemistry's structures, properties, and reactions. Through this programme student can gain these skills while covering Physical, Inorganic and Organic Chemistry.

This course is a Physical Science course that examines multiple Substances, Particles, Fragments, Molecules, Crystals and other aggregates of matter, whether in isolation or alliance and which includes the concepts of energy and entropy about the spontaneity of chemical processes.

B.Sc. in Chemistry is a 3/4 Years (Without / With Research) undergraduate degree that focuses on the study of chemical properties, reactions, and applications of matter. It includes both theoretical knowledge and practical laboratory training in inorganic, organic, and physical chemistry.

The candidate must have passed 10+2 with Chemistry as a mandatory subject from a recognized board or its equivalent, with a minimum of 45% marks.

A B.Sc. in Chemistry opens up diverse career opportunities in fields like pharmaceuticals, research, environmental science, and chemical industries. Graduates can work as chemists, lab technicians, quality controllers, or pursue higher studies and research. The degree also offers a strong foundation for careers in healthcare, education, and forensic science.

After completing a B.Sc. in Chemistry, the starting salary typically ranges from ₹2.5 to ₹4 lakhs per year, depending on the job role and industry. With experience or higher qualifications, salaries can increase significantly, especially in pharmaceuticals, research, and quality control sectors.

Absolutely. If you're interested in research and innovation, B.Sc. Chemistry is a strong foundation. You can pursue M.Sc. and Ph.D. and work in R&D, materials science, nanotechnology, or medicinal chemistry.

No, to become a licensed pharmacist, you must complete a B.Pharma (Bachelor of Pharmacy). However, B.Sc. Chemistry graduates can work in pharmaceutical companies in QA, QC, or R&D roles.

Yes, especially if you’re curious about the science of substances and enjoy lab work. It offers diverse opportunities in education, research, industry, and public sector roles.
